Resolution 2023/21 Moved: Member Jessie McVeagh Seconded: Member Chicky Rudkin That the Kaikohe-Hokianga Community Board: a) approve the sum of $700.00 (plus GST if applicable) be paid from the Board’s Placemaking Fund account to Valerie August for the Matariki 2023 exhibition in Rawene to support the following Community Outcomes: i) Proud, vibrant communities ii) Communities that are healthy, safe, connected and sustainable. |
Resolution 2023/22 Moved: Member Harmonie Gundry Seconded: Member Trinity Edwards That the Kaikohe-Hokianga Community Board: b) approve the sum of $1572.70 (plus GST if applicable) be paid from the Board’s Community Grant Fund account and $427.30 from the Boards Placemaking Fund (a total of $2000) to Volunteering Northland for support of volunteer engagement and organisations in the Kaikohe-Hokianga Ward to support the following Community Outcomes: i) Proud, vibrant communities ii) Communities that are healthy, safe, connected and sustainable. |
Resolution 2023/23 Moved: Member Jessie McVeagh Seconded: Member Harmonie Gundry That the Kaikohe-Hokianga Community Board: c) approve the sum of $5000 (plus GST if applicable) be paid from the Board’s Placemaking Fund account to Whatu Creative for the Matariki 2023 Weaving the Strands together workshops to support the following Community Outcomes: i) Proud, vibrant communities ii) Communities that are healthy, safe, connected and sustainable. |

8.4 Major Item not on the Agenda |
Moved: Member Harmonie Gundry Seconded: Member Jessie McVeagh That the Kaikohe-Hokianga Community Board resolve to discuss and allocate the remaining Placemaking funds of $47,222.70. This cannot be delayed as the funds must be allocated before the end of the 2022/23 financial year. |
|
Resolution 2023/29 Moved: Member Jessie McVeagh Seconded: Member Harmonie Gundry That the Kaikohe-Hokianga Community Board a) approve the sum of $10,000 (plus GST if applicable) be paid from the Board’s Placemaking Fund account to the Rural Travel Fund for the benefit of tamariki in the Kaikohe-Hokianga Ward to participate in sport to support the following Community Outcomes: i) Proud, vibrant communities ii) Communities that are healthy, safe, connected and sustainable. |
Resolution 2023/30 Moved: Member Jessie McVeagh Seconded: Member Trinity Edwards That the Kaikohe-Hokianga Community Board a) approves the sum of $37,222.70 (plus GST if applicable) be paid from the Board’s Placemaking Fund account, on receipt of a funding application, to the Community Business and Environment Centre (CBEC) to support the following Community Outcomes: i) Proud, vibrant communities ii) Communities that are healthy, safe, connected and sustainable. |
